Answer:
Mt. Rainier and Mt. Baker in Washington are the snowiest places in the United States.
Explanation:
Then, Utah, Oregon, California, Alaska, and Colorado form the top 5 snowiest places in the USA.
The 24 hours snowing without stopping was recorded at Silver Lake, Colorado.
The snowstorm began at 2:30 pm on the afternoon of April 14, 1921,
and lasted until 6 pm on April 15.
